CONFIRMATION
For United Methodists, Confirmation marks when, typically, a young person "confirms" their intention to live the vows of baptism and becomes a member of The United Methodist Church. In less churchy terms, youth take their faith to the next level and, if they choose, commit to living the way of Christ.
